So, if you are looking to spice up your Spore experience, you don't have to put yourself through the agony of installing countless mods you don't know, like I did. Just install dark injection, auto save and some graphic patches, and tweak some game files to skip the intro and unlock your FPS. On top of it all, install Reshade and you have the ultimate Spore experience.
